位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el百科 > 文章详情

c excel 转html

作者:百问excel教程网
|
82人看过
发布时间:2025-12-26 03:14:11
标签:
Excel 转 HTML:从数据处理到网页展示的全面解析在数据处理与展示的领域中,Excel 作为一款广泛应用的电子表格工具,拥有强大的数据处理能力。然而,对于需要将 Excel 数据以网页形式展示的用户而言,Excel 转
c excel 转html
Excel 转 HTML:从数据处理到网页展示的全面解析
在数据处理与展示的领域中,Excel 作为一款广泛应用的电子表格工具,拥有强大的数据处理能力。然而,对于需要将 Excel 数据以网页形式展示的用户而言,Excel 转 HTML 的过程则显得尤为重要。本文将从理论基础、操作流程、功能特点、应用场景、技术实现、注意事项等多个方面,深入解析 Excel 转 HTML 的全过程,帮助用户全面掌握这一技能。
一、Excel 转 HTML 的基本概念
Excel 转 HTML 是将 Excel 表格数据转换为 HTML 文件,从而在网页上显示或进一步处理数据。这一过程通常用于将 Excel 中的数据以网页形式展示,便于用户在浏览器中查看、编辑或集成到网站中。
在 Excel 中,数据以表格形式存储,而 HTML 是一种标记语言,用于构建网页结构。将 Excel 转 HTML 的核心目标是将 Excel 中的数据以网页格式呈现,从而实现数据的可视化与交互性。
二、Excel 转 HTML 的常见方法
1. 使用 Excel 内置功能
Excel 提供了“另存为 HTML”功能,用户可以通过此功能直接将 Excel 表格转换为 HTML 文件。操作步骤如下:
1. 打开 Excel 文件;
2. 点击“文件”菜单;
3. 选择“另存为”;
4. 在“保存类型”中选择“HTML 文件(.htm 或 .)”;
5. 设置保存路径与文件名;
6. 点击“保存”。
此方法操作简单,适合对 HTML 有一定了解的用户。
2. 使用 VBA 宏
对于有一定编程能力的用户,可以使用 VBA(Visual Basic for Applications)编写宏,实现 Excel 转 HTML 的自动化处理。VBA 允许用户通过代码将 Excel 数据转换为 HTML 文件,适用于需要批量处理或复杂数据转换的场景。
3. 使用在线工具
有许多在线工具支持 Excel 转 HTML,例如:
- ConvertToHTML.com:提供免费的 Excel 转 HTML 工具;
- OnlineConvert:支持多种文件格式转换,包括 Excel 到 HTML;
- ExcelToHTML:专门用于 Excel 数据转换为 HTML 文件。
这些工具操作简单,适合非技术用户快速完成数据转换。
三、Excel 转 HTML 的核心功能
1. 数据保留与完整性
Excel 转 HTML 的核心功能之一是保留数据的完整性。转换过程中,Excel 中的单元格内容、公式、格式、图片等信息都会被保留,确保转换后的 HTML 文件与原始 Excel 文件数据一致。
2. 表格结构保留
Excel 中的表格结构(如列宽、行高、边框、填充颜色等)在转换为 HTML 时都会被保留,确保表格在网页中呈现美观、整洁的样式。
3. 可编辑性与交互性
转换后的 HTML 文件可以在浏览器中直接编辑,用户可以对数据进行修改、排序、筛选等操作。此外,HTML 的结构化特性使得用户可以进一步添加脚本、样式等,增强网页的交互性。
4. 跨平台兼容性
HTML 是一种独立于平台的格式,因此 Excel 转 HTML 后,数据可以在任何浏览器中查看,支持 PC、手机、平板等多终端访问。
四、Excel 转 HTML 的应用场景
1. 企业数据展示
企业通常需要将大量数据以网页形式展示,从而便于管理层查看、分析。Excel 转 HTML 可用于生成企业报表、市场分析报告等。
2. 网页内容生成
在网页开发中,Excel 转 HTML 可用于生成动态网页内容。例如,将客户信息、产品数据等转换为 HTML 文件,用于展示在网站上。
3. 数据可视化
Excel 转 HTML 可用于将 Excel 数据转换为网页图表,如柱状图、饼图、折线图等,从而实现数据的可视化展示。
4. 数据整合与共享
Excel 转 HTML 可用于将 Excel 数据集成到网站中,便于团队协作与数据共享,提高工作效率。
五、Excel 转 HTML 的技术实现
1. Excel 内置功能
Excel 内置的“另存为 HTML”功能是实现 Excel 转 HTML 的最直接方式。这一功能通过 Excel 的“文件”菜单实现,操作简单,适合普通用户。
2. VBA 宏实现
VBA 宏可以实现更复杂的数据转换,例如:
- 将 Excel 表格转换为 HTML 文件;
- 添加额外的样式、脚本;
- 预处理数据,如去重、排序、筛选等。
VBA 的编程能力较强,适合需要自动化处理的用户。
3. 编程语言实现
对于高级用户,可以使用编程语言(如 Python、JavaScript)实现 Excel 转 HTML 的自动化处理。Python 有库如 `pandas` 和 `openpyxl`,可读取 Excel 文件并生成 HTML;JavaScript 可通过 DOM 操作实现 HTML 文件的生成。
六、Excel 转 HTML 的注意事项
1. 数据格式兼容性
Excel 文件中包含多种数据格式,如文本、数字、日期、公式等。在转换为 HTML 时,需确保这些数据在 HTML 文件中正确显示,避免格式错误或数据丢失。
2. 表格结构保持
在转换过程中,需注意表格的结构保持,包括列宽、行高、边框、填充颜色等,以确保表格在网页中呈现美观。
3. 兼容性与性能
HTML 文件在不同浏览器中可能呈现不同效果,需注意浏览器兼容性。此外,大型 Excel 文件转换为 HTML 可能会占用较多内存和时间,需合理规划数据量。
4. 数据安全与隐私
在将 Excel 数据转换为 HTML 时,需注意数据的安全性,避免敏感信息泄露。
七、Excel 转 HTML 的未来趋势
随着数据处理与网页开发技术的不断发展,Excel 转 HTML 的应用场景将进一步扩展。未来,随着 AI 技术的引入,Excel 转 HTML 可能实现更智能的数据处理与展示,例如:
- 自动化数据格式转换;
- 智能数据筛选与分析;
- 自动化生成网页内容。
此外,随着 Web 技术的演进,HTML 与 Excel 的结合将更加紧密,实现更高效的跨平台数据处理与展示。
八、总结
Excel 转 HTML 是将 Excel 数据以网页形式展示的重要手段,适用于企业数据展示、网页内容生成、数据可视化等多个场景。通过 Excel 内置功能、VBA 宏、在线工具或编程语言,用户可以灵活实现 Excel 转 HTML 的操作。在使用过程中,需注意数据格式、表格结构、兼容性与性能等关键问题。随着技术的发展,Excel 转 HTML 的应用场景将更加广泛,成为数据处理与展示中不可或缺的一部分。
通过本文的详细解析,用户可以全面了解 Excel 转 HTML 的机制、操作方法与应用场景,从而提升数据处理与网页开发的能力。
推荐文章
相关文章
推荐URL
Excel 宽度自适应:提升数据展示效率的实用技巧Excel 是一个功能强大的电子表格工具,广泛应用于数据分析、财务建模、报表生成等场景。在实际使用中,数据的宽度往往会影响用户对信息的直观理解。因此,Excel 提供了“宽度自适应”(
2025-12-26 03:13:39
124人看过
CMVC框架中Excel导出的实践与实现在现代Web开发中,数据的交互与展示是前端与后端紧密合作的重要环节。其中,Excel文件的导出是一个常见的需求,尤其是在数据统计、报表生成、数据迁移等场景中。CMVC(Controlle
2025-12-26 03:13:06
153人看过
C 查询数据并生成 Excel 发送邮件的完整流程指南在现代数据处理与自动化办公中,C 语言作为一门基础且强大的编程语言,常被用于构建定制化的数据处理脚本。本文将详细介绍如何通过 C 语言编写程序,实现数据查询、生成 Excel 文
2025-12-26 03:12:58
52人看过
C++ 中创建 Excel 文件的深度解析与实践指南在软件开发中,数据处理是一项基础而重要的任务。C++ 作为一门高性能、面向对象的编程语言,凭借其强大的性能和灵活性,广泛应用于各类系统开发中。对于需要频繁处理 Excel 数据的开发
2025-12-26 03:12:58
175人看过
热门推荐
热门专题:
资讯中心: